enclosure Commands
enclosure set door
To lock or unlock a specific door on a specific SAF-TE enclosure 
management device, use the enclosure set door command.
Syntax
enclosure set door [/lock{=boolean}] {enclosure} 
{door}
Parameters
{enclosure}
Specifies the ID associated with the enclosure management 
device on which you want to lock the door. For this version, 
the controller supports a maximum of eight enclosure 
management devices on each bus. 
{door}
Specifies the unit number of the door for which you want to 
set the lock. This number can range from 0 to 15 inclusive.
Switches
/lock{=boolean}
Specifies whether to lock the door associated with the 
specified unit number. If you set this switch to TRUE, the 
command locks the door associated with the specified unit 
number. If you set this switch to FALSE, the command 
unlocks the door associated with the specified unit number.
This switch defaults to FALSE.
Examples
The following example locks the door associated with unit 1 on 
enclosure management device 0:
AAC0>enclosure set door /lock=TRUE 0 1
Executing: enclosure set door /lock=TRUE 0 1
